How to Make Chicken Parmesan Soup
Step 1: Prepare the aromatics
Begin by heating ol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add chopped onions and minced garlic, stirring frequently until they become fragrant and translucent, about 3-4 minutes. This layer of flavor sets the base for the soup.
Step 2: Add smoked turkey and seasonings
Next, toss in the thinly sliced smoked turkey pieces, allowing them to warm through and release their smoky flavor. Sprinkle in Italian herbs (natural), salt, and pepper to amplify the aroma and overall taste profile.
Step 3: Incorporate liquids and chicken
Pour in the crushed tomatoes and chicken broth, stirring to combine with the other ingredients. Add shredded cooked chicken to the pot. Bring everything to a gentle simmer, letting the flavors meld for about 10 minutes.
Step 4: Add natural gelling agent and plant-based cheese
Stir in the natural gelling agent and plant-based cheese (plant-based), mixing gently until the soup begins to thicken slightly and the cheese melts fully into the broth, creating a creamy consistency.
Step 5: Final touches
Adjust seasoning to taste. Just before serving, add a sprinkle of grated plant-based Parmesan (plant-based) on top for a burst of cheesy delight and a finishing touch.

Ingredients
Proteins
- 1 cup cooked, shredded chicken breast
- 1/2 cup thinly sliced smoked turkey slices
Vegetables and Aromatics
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 can (14 oz) crushed tomatoes
Liquids and Fats
- 3 cups low-sodium chicken broth
- 2 tablespoons olive oil (natural)
Dairy Alternatives and Seasonings
- 1 cup plant-based cheese (plant-based)
- 1 teaspoon Italian herbs (natural) (basil, oregano, thyme mix)
- 1 teaspoon natural gelling agent
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
- Grated plant-based Parmesan (plant-based), for garnish
Instructions
- Prepare the aromatics: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add the chopped onions and minced garlic, stirring frequently until fragrant and translucent, about 3-4 minutes. This forms the flavorful base of the soup.
- Add smoked turkey and seasonings: Toss in the thinly sliced smoked turkey pieces and stir allowing them to warm through and release their smoky flavor. Sprinkle in Italian herbs (natural), salt, and pepper to enhance the aroma and taste.
- Incorporate liquids and chicken: Pour in the crushed tomatoes and chicken broth, stirring to combine. Add the shredded cooked chicken to the pot.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er and let flavors meld for about 10 minutes.
- Add natural gelling agent and plant-based cheese: Stir in the natural gelling agent and plant-based cheese (plant-based), mixing gently until the soup thickens slightly and the cheese fully melts into the broth, creating a creamy consistency.
- Final touches: Adjust seasoning to taste. Just before serving, sprinkle grated plant-based Parmesan (plant-based) on top to add a burst of cheesy flavor and an authentic finishing touch.
